Copper: Building Blocks of the Future
Copper is indispensable to the advancement of modern technology. Its unique properties, such as high ability to conduct electricity, malleability, and durability, make it an essential component in a wide range of applications. From smart devices to telecommunications, copper's impact is unmistakable.
- {Its use in wiring and circuitry allows for the transmission of data and power with minimal loss, underpinning the functionality of modern electronics.
- {Copper plays a vital role in the production of transformers, which are crucial for efficiently distributing electricity across power grids.
- In renewable energy technologies, copper is used in solar panels, wind turbines, and electric vehicle batteries, contributing to a sustainable future.
